The College of Business Personalized Academic Curricular Experience (PACE) Program offers each student a thematic learning experience that focuses on their career interest and aspiration.
The Dean's Student internship Program is a compensated work experience that provides students with an opportunity to work with a member of the College of Business Leadership team on an externally driven project with regional business or community leaders.
Among the many additional Experiential Learning Initiatives sponsored by the College Business are Corporate Challenge, a competition where teams of Business students complete for awards and prizes, and three-tiered Mentoring Program (Business-Leader-to-Student, e-mentoring, and Student-to-Student).
